# Pantry Inventory App
|
|
|
|
A simple web app for tracking kitchen pantry items across your household.
|
|
|
|
**Live demo:** https://pantry.kestrelsnest.social
|
|
|
|
## Features
|
|
|
|
- **Search** - Instantly filter ingredients by name
|
|
- **Filter tabs** - View All, In Stock, Out of Stock, Recent, or by category
|
|
- **Category tabs** - Filter by item category (Flours, Spices, Pasta, Baking, etc.)
|
|
- **Container filtering** - Click any container type in the legend to filter by it
|
|
- **Container tracking** - Multiple container types organized by category with color-coded indicators
|
|
- **Stock status** - Mark items as in-stock or out-of-stock
|
|
- **Shopping list** - Tap the "Out of Stock" count to copy all out-of-stock items to clipboard
|
|
- **PIN protection** - Anyone can view, but editing requires a 4-digit PIN
|
|
- **QR Code** - Generate a scannable code to post on your pantry shelf
|
|
- **OpenGraph card** - Nice preview when sharing on social media
|
|

## Deployment on YunoHost (My Webapp)
|
|
|
|
### 1. Install My Webapp
|
|
|
|
In YunoHost admin panel:
|
|
1. Go to **Applications** → **Install**
|
|
2. Search for "My Webapp"
|
|
3. Configure:
|
|
- **Label**: Pantry
|
|
- **Domain/Path**: e.g., `pantry.yourdomain.com`
|
|
- **PHP version**: 8.2 or higher
|
|
- **Database**: None needed
|
|
4. Install
|
|
|
|
### 2. Upload Files
|
|
|
|
Upload to the `www` folder:
|
|
- `index.html`
|
|
- `api.php`
|
|
- `containers.json`
|
|
- `categories.json`
|
|
- `og-image.png`
|
|
|
|
### 3. Set Permissions
|
|
|
|
The `data` folder needs to be writable by the web server user (typically `my_webapp__X`):
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# SSH into your YunoHost server
|
|
cd /var/www/my_webapp__X/www
|
|
mkdir -p data
|
|
sudo chown my_webapp__X:my_webapp__X data
|
|
chmod 775 data
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Important:** Files in `data/` must be owned by the web server user, not your admin user, or edits won't save.
|
|
|
|
### 4. First Use
|
|
|
|
1. Visit your app URL
|
|
2. Tap the lock icon → Set a 4-digit PIN
|
|
3. Add your pantry items
|
|
4. Share the PIN with family members who need edit access
|
|
5. Print the QR code for your pantry shelf
|

## Security Notes
|
|
|
|
- The PIN is stored in plain text - adequate for household use to prevent accidental edits
|
|
- Anyone with the URL can view your inventory
|
|
- For more security, put the app behind YunoHost's SSO
|
|
|
|
## Troubleshooting
|
|
|
|
**"Connection error" message**
|
|
- Check that PHP is enabled for your My Webapp instance
|
|
- Verify the `data` folder exists and is writable
|
|
|
|
**Edits not saving**
|
|
- Check that `data/inventory.json` is owned by the web server user, not your admin user
|
|
- Run: `sudo chown my_webapp__X:my_webapp__X data/inventory.json`
|
|
|
|
**Special characters displaying as HTML entities**
|
|
- The API's `sanitize()` function should only trim whitespace, not HTML-encode
|
|
- Re-save affected items through the UI to fix
|
